    I fished a statewide bass tournament years ago. It was a fairly high dollar tournament. The rule was everybody had to use the same type of lure. Plastic worm to be exact. Judges inspected each boat before launching. They found that a boat had the bottom cut out of a plastic fuel tank and slipped over top of a fully equipped tackle box. He also was banned from future events.

    I would venture to say this is not his first time nor is he the only one cheating. The rules, the way that they are currently written, allowed him and others the one inch that it took to take advantage of the flaws. Launching from multiple ramps with no checks prior to launch leave the door wide open for this to happen. When money is on the line people will go to great length to collect it.
